|
Schedule of bank and other borrowings (Details)
|12 Months Ended
|
Jun. 30, 2025
USD ($)
|
Jun. 30, 2025
GBP (£)
|
Jun. 30, 2024
GBP (£)
|Total
|$ 8,397,806
|£ 6,120,322
|£ 7,903,782
|Less: current maturities
|(8,397,806)
|(6,120,322)
|(7,766,282)
|Non-current maturities
|137,500
|DBS Bank Ltd One [Member]
|Total
|$ 1,094,175
|£ 797,435
|£ 859,639
|Maturity date, description
|On demand
|Weighted average interest rate
|6.09%
|6.09%
|6.50%
|DBS Bank Ltd Two [Member]
|Total
|$ 254,822
|£ 185,714
|£ 644,821
|Maturity date, description
|Within 1 year
|Weighted average interest rate
|6.19%
|6.19%
|6.00%
|DBS Bank Ltd Three [Member]
|Total
|$ 771,500
|£ 562,270
|£ 649,464
|Maturity date, description
|December 30, 2036 or on demand
|Weighted average interest rate
|5.78%
|5.78%
|6.00%
|DBS Bank Ltd Four [Member]
|Total
|$ 220,515
|£ 160,712
|£ 194,775
|Maturity date, description
|June 30, 2032 or on demand
|Weighted average interest rate
|5.87%
|5.87%
|6.00%
|DBS Bank Ltd Five [Member]
|Total
|$ 461,599
|£ 336,413
|£ 405,010
|Maturity date, description
|September 13, 2033 or on demand
|Weighted average interest rate
|3.44%
|3.44%
|3.63%
|Standard Chartered Bank Ltd One [Member]
|Total
|£ 125,791
|Maturity date, description
|November 12, 2029 or on demand
|Weighted average interest rate
|3.62%
|Standard Chartered Bank Ltd Two [Member]
|Total
|£ 85,555
|Maturity date, description
|August 7, 2028 or on demand
|Weighted average interest rate
|3.62%
|Standard Chartered Bank Ltd Three [Member]
|Total
|£ 111,336
|Maturity date, description
|December 7, 2028 or on demand
|Weighted average interest rate
|3.62%
|China Citic Bank International One [Member]
|Total
|$ 2,397,999
|£ 1,747,663
|£ 1,905,457
|Maturity date, description
|Within one year
|Weighted average interest rate
|4.73%
|4.73%
|5.00%
|China Citic Bank International Two [Member]
|Total
|$ 1,131,029
|£ 824,294
|£ 930,828
|Maturity date, description
|July 9, 2042 or on demand
|Weighted average interest rate
|4.78%
|4.78%
|5.46%
|China Citic Bank International Three [Member]
|Total
|$ 327,591
|£ 238,748
|£ 260,304
|Maturity date, description
|Within one year
|Weighted average interest rate
|5.99%
|5.99%
|5.90%
|Bank of East Asia [Member]
|Total
|$ 130,487
|£ 95,099
|£ 124,342
|Maturity date, description
|January 27, 2030 or on demand
|Weighted average interest rate
|3.47%
|3.47%
|3.50%
|Bank of Communications Hong Kong One [Member]
|Total
|$ 313,830
|£ 228,719
|£ 346,487
|Maturity date, description
|April 7, 2027 or on demand
|Weighted average interest rate
|6.00%
|6.00%
|5.13%
|Bank of Communications Hong Kong Two [Member]
|Total
|£ 164,438
|Weighted average interest rate
|6.84%
|Maturity date
|May 16, 2026
|Natwest Westminster Bank PLC One [Member]
|Total
|$ 148,646
|£ 108,333
|£ 208,333
|Weighted average interest rate
|5.31%
|5.31%
|5.01%
|Maturity date
|Jul. 20, 2026
|Natwest Westminster Bank PLC Two [Member]
|Total
|$ 40,021
|£ 29,167
|£ 79,167
|Weighted average interest rate
|5.31%
|5.31%
|5.21%
|Maturity date
|Jan. 21, 2026
|Arbuthnot Latham and Co Ltd [Member]
|Total
|£ 666,055
|Maturity date, description
|Within 1 year
|Weighted average interest rate
|6.23%
|White Oak No. 6 Limited [Member]
|Total
|$ 522,049
|£ 380,469
|Maturity date, description
|Within 1 year
|Weighted average interest rate
|18.13%
|18.13%
|IWOCA Limited [Member]
|Total
|$ 380,266
|£ 277,138
|Maturity date, description
|Within 1 year
|Weighted average interest rate
|39.80%
|39.80%
|RCH Capital Ltd [Member]
|Total
|$ 203,277
|£ 148,148
|£ 141,980
|Maturity date, description
|Within 1 year
|Weighted average interest rate
|26.22%
|26.22%
|24.21%
|X
- Definition
+ References
Date when the debt instrument is scheduled to be fully repaid, in YYYY-MM-DD format.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Description of the maturity date of the debt instrument including whether the debt matures serially and, if so, a brief description of the serial maturities.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Weighted average interest rate of debt outstanding.
+ Details
No definition available.
|X
- Definition
+ References
The carrying amount as of the balance sheet date for the aggregate of other miscellaneous borrowings owed by the reporting entity.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of long-term debt classified as other, payable after one year or the operating cycle, if longer.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of borrowings classified as other, maturing within one year or the normal operating cycle, if longer.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details